Crawlspace Waterproofing in Fort Collins, CO
Crawlspace waterproofing services focus on protecting the area beneath a home from excess moisture, water intrusion, and potential flooding. This service typically involves installing drainage systems, vapor barriers, sump pumps, and sealing any cracks or gaps that may allow water to seep in. Property owners often request this type of work when experiencing persistent dampness, mold growth, or musty odors in the crawlspace, as these issues can impact indoor air quality and the structural integrity of the home.
Before requesting crawlspace waterproofing, homeowners usually want to understand the extent of water problems, the causes of moisture intrusion, and the best solutions to prevent future issues. It’s important to consider the local climate, drainage patterns, and existing foundation conditions. Clear communication about the scope of the project, expected outcomes, and any necessary preparatory work can help ensure the waterproofing measures effectively protect the property over time.

Common Crawlspace Waterproofing Jobs
Basement Crawlspace Waterproofing - prevents water intrusion and protects your home’s foundation.
Vapor Barrier Installation - controls moisture levels and reduces mold growth.
Drainage System Setup - directs water away from the crawlspace to prevent flooding.
Sealant Applications - closes gaps and cracks to block moisture entry points.
Dehumidification Solutions - maintains optimal humidity levels for a healthier crawlspace.
Leak Repair Services - addresses existing leaks to prevent ongoing water damage.
Crawlspace Waterproofing Questions
What is crawlspace waterproofing? It involves sealing and protecting the crawlspace to prevent water intrusion and moisture buildup that can cause damage and mold.
Why is waterproofing important for a crawlspace? Proper waterproofing helps maintain a dry environment, reduces structural issues, and improves indoor air quality.
What types of issues can waterproofing address? It can help prevent basement flooding, wood rot, mold growth, and damage caused by excess moisture or groundwater.
How does waterproofing typically work? It usually includes sealing cracks, installing drainage systems, and applying moisture barriers to keep water out.
